Understanding the Role of a Buyers Agent

A buyers agent is more than just a facilitator in property transactions. They are your strategic ally, offering insightful advice, in-depth market analysis, and adept negotiation skills. Their primary role is to align your investment objectives with the right property choices, ensuring that your ventures are profitable and aligned with your goals.

Setting Clear Investment Goals

Prior to searching for a buyers agent for investment property, it’s essential to define your investment objectives. Are you looking for immediate returns or long-term growth? Residential or commercial ventures? Understanding your own goals will guide you in selecting a buyers agent for investment property with the expertise you need.

Experience in Investment Property Matters

The experience of your buyers agent for investments is crucial. Agents specialising in the property type you’re interested in will likely offer more valuable insights and opportunities. Therefore, ensure that your chosen buyers agent has a proven track record in the specific investment property market you are considering.

Local Market Insight Is Key

A great buyers agent for investment property possesses extensive local market knowledge. They should be well-informed about the latest market trends, property values, and areas with potential for growth. Such knowledge is vital for a buyers agent to identify the most lucrative investment opportunities.

Effective Communication and Transparency

A successful relationship with a buyers agent for investment property hinges on clear communication. They should be approachable and transparent in their dealings, providing you with regular updates and honest advice.

Reputation and Client Feedback

Prior to choosing a buyers agent for investment property, consider their reputation. Reviews and testimonials from past clients can provide valuable insights into their effectiveness and client satisfaction levels.

Negotiation Skills and Extensive Network

An exceptional buyers agent for investment property should excel in negotiations, as this can significantly affect your investment’s success. Additionally, their network can grant you access to exclusive, off-market properties, giving you a competitive advantage.

Understanding of Fees and Charges

Be aware of the fee structure of your buyers agent for investment property. Whether they charge a flat fee or commission, understanding these costs is essential for making an informed choice.

Building Trust and Rapport

Finally, ensure there is a trust-based relationship with your buyers agent. Choose an agent who aligns with your investment philosophy and with whom you can build a strong, collaborative relationship.

4 FAQs About a Buyers Agent!

1.What Is a Buyer’s Agent?

A buyer’s agent is a licensed real estate professional who represents the interests of the buyer in a real estate transaction. Unlike a listing agent, who represents the seller, a buyers agent works exclusively for the buyer, offering advice, sourcing properties, negotiating prices, and assisting throughout the buying process to ensure their client’s best interests are met.

2.Why Should I Use a Buyers Agent?

Utilising a buyers agent can provide several advantages:

Expertise: They have extensive knowledge of the real estate market, which can be invaluable in finding the right property at the right price.

Time-Saving: A buyers agent does the legwork in searching for properties, which saves you time.

Negotiation Skills: They are experienced in negotiating real estate deals, potentially saving you money.

Representation: A buyers agent represents your interests, ensuring that the property you choose is a good fit for your needs and budget.

3.How Does a Buyers Agent Get Paid?

Buyers agents typically receive a commission, which is often a percentage of the property’s sale price. This commission is usually paid by the seller, even though the agent is working on behalf of the buyer. In some cases, a buyers agent may charge a flat fee or an hourly rate instead of a commission.

4.What Should I Look for in a Buyers Agent?

When selecting a buyers agent, consider the following factors:

Experience and Credentials: Look for an agent with a strong track record and relevant qualifications.

Local Market Knowledge: Choose an agent who is knowledgeable about the area where you wish to buy.

Communication Style: Ensure their communication style matches your preferences.

References and Reviews: Check their references and read reviews from previous clients to assess their reputation and effectiveness.
